Uroflowmetry is a non-invasive procedure that records the speed of your urine discharge. This technique uses a specific machine to analyze how quickly and forcefully you release your bladder . Results from the test can help doctors diagnose different conditions, like prostate enlargement , difficulty urinating, and sometimes even nerve problems affecting bladder function. Ultimately, uroflowmetry provides valuable insight into the status of your urinary system.

Uroflowmetry & Urodynamic Assessment : Identifying Urinary Issues

To accurately evaluate the cause of voiding dysfunction, physicians frequently employ urine flow studies and urodynamic evaluations . Uroflowmetry measures the volume of urination during a simple process of emptying, providing valuable insight into the power of the bladder's squeeze . More comprehensive urodynamic studies involve a series of tests that assess various aspects of the lower urinary tract, including bladder pressure , urethral resistance , and the overall synchronization of bladder and sphincter function . These techniques can help locate conditions like urinary urgency, incontinence, bladder outlet obstruction , and neurological disorders affecting lower urinary tract health.
